*Asbestos free means contains 0% asbestos in any form.
Therefore, IACS adopted IACS Unified Interpretation (UI) SC249 in October 2011, which requires that an asbestos-free declaration be made to confirm that materials containing asbestos are not being used.
An Asbestos Declaration is a mandatory document for importers and exporters involved in international freight to confirm that their goods are free of asbestos, as importing or exporting asbestos-containing products is prohibited in Australia.

The latest directive, (EU) 2023/2668, represents a pivotal shift in how the European Union approaches asbestos exposure in the workplace. Building on the foundation laid by the original Asbestos at Work Directive, this amendment integrates the most recent scientific evidence to bolster worker protection.
